Benton County To Make Significant Upgrades To E911 Service

Improvements are on the way for the Benton County E-911 Center.

Director Jessica Mayfield tells the Benton County Enterprise that they’re bringing their center “up to full staff” and modernizing all equipment.

That includes new dispatching consoles, which replace the ones put into use in 2004 when the center first opened.

Mayfield, who became director in October, says the goal is to have better communication’s with other jurisdictions and to make sure the staff is fully trained.

There are three dispatchers currently undergoing training and Mayfield hopes to hire three more in the coming year.
